摘要
This paper introduced the process of client downloading files from the Hadoop distributed file system, in the process of downloading files were studied for the user experience is poor and possible load imbalance problem, proposed a parallel download programs, and in the process of downloading data blocks from multiple backup data storage Datallodes, used an improved rate of adaptive dynamic parallel downloading mechanism. Experimental results show that the improved download strategy greatly reduces the waiting time of the client downloading files from the Hadoop distributed file system. Parallel download can improve Hadoop distributed file system download efficiency and make the Datallode more balanced load.
